The Family
Originally released in 1970. The Family is a crime/drama film. directed by En Cognito. At just 45 minutes, it's a tight, focused story.
Starring Neola Graef, William Howard, and Gene Rowland
Synopsis
A family of free loving hippies turn lethal when they exact revenge upon the innocent girlfriend of a sleazy double crosser!
